Elysia XFILTER 500 - Stereo EQ 500 Series Module

The Elysia xfilter 500 is a true linked stereo EQ in the 500 series format. It gives you the expensive sound of an all class-A equalizer in a surprisingly affordable package, with a precise stereo image based on computer-selected, stepped potentiometers and low tolerance film capacitors. With its exceptionally open sound, straight transient projection and solid punch, the xfilter 500 is the perfect match for your xpressor|neo 500 – or any other piece of outboard gear! xfilter 500 is absolutely serious about flexibility. It offers high and low shelf bands which can be switched into high and low cut filters with resonance, two mid peak filters with wide and narrow Q, plus additional passive LC stages with shielded coils for a glorious top end.

Elysia xfilter 500 Specifications

  • Frequency response: <10 Hz – 400 kHz (-3,0 dB)
  • THD+N @ 0 dBu, 20 Hz – 22 kHz: 0,006 %
  • THD+N @ +10 dBu, 20 Hz – 22 kHz: 0,01 %
  • Noise floor, 20 Hz – 22 kHz (A-weighted): -98 dBu
  • Dynamic range, 20 Hz – 22 kHz: 112 dB
  • Input level: +21 dBu
  • Output level: +21 dBu
  • Input impedance: 10 kOhm
  • Output impedance: 68 Ohm
  • Dimensions: 2 Slot 500 Series Module
  • Weight: 1,01 lbs / 0,47 kg
  • Power consumption:  210 mA
  • Potentiometers: 41 Steps
